Cool! Good to see.

A few small suggestions, but nothing major. All your git commits are
"file upload" apart from the occasional web edit; I would recommend
getting familiar with command-line git and making commits with useful
messages. (I was hoping to have a look at the changes that you did for
Py2 -> Py3, but couldn't find them in the pile of big changes.) I'd
also suggest getting an actual LICENSE or COPYING file, since your
README says your code is GPL'd. And you may want to look into the
formatting of your README - there are a few things that probably
should be turned into bulleted lists rather than flowing as
paragraphs. But otherwise, cool! I like to see this sort of thing
published and open sourced.
